diff --git a/src/Umbraco.Web.UI.Client/src/packages/core/store/file-system-item.store.ts b/src/Umbraco.Web.UI.Client/src/packages/core/store/file-system-item.store.ts deleted file mode 100644 index ae2876901c..0000000000 --- a/src/Umbraco.Web.UI.Client/src/packages/core/store/file-system-item.store.ts +++ /dev/null @@ -1,26 +0,0 @@ -import { UmbStoreBase } from './store-base.js'; -import { UmbArrayState } from '@umbraco-cms/backoffice/observable-api'; -import type { UmbControllerHost } from '@umbraco-cms/backoffice/controller-api'; - -/** - * @export - * @class UmbFileSystemItemStore - * @extends {UmbStoreBase} - * @description - Data Store for File system items - */ - -export class UmbFileSystemItemStore extends UmbStoreBase { - constructor(host: UmbControllerHost, storeAlias: string) { - super(host, storeAlias, new UmbArrayState([], (x) => x.path)); - } - - /** - * Return an observable to observe file system items - * @param {Array} paths - * @return {*} - * @memberof UmbFileSystemItemStore - */ - items(paths: Array) { - return this._data.asObservablePart((items) => items.filter((item) => paths.includes(item.path ?? ''))); - } -} diff --git a/src/Umbraco.Web.UI.Client/src/packages/core/store/index.ts b/src/Umbraco.Web.UI.Client/src/packages/core/store/index.ts index 9b03c755d5..0463b3036a 100644 --- a/src/Umbraco.Web.UI.Client/src/packages/core/store/index.ts +++ b/src/Umbraco.Web.UI.Client/src/packages/core/store/index.ts @@ -2,7 +2,6 @@ export * from './store-base.js'; export * from './store.interface.js'; export * from './store.js'; export * from './entity-item.store.js'; -export * from './file-system-item.store.js'; export { UmbDetailStoreBase } from './detail-store-base.js'; export type { UmbDetailStore } from './detail-store.interface.js';